    Let’s talk about some more oddities surrounding the alleged “IS-K” attack on the Crocus City Center. Initially we were told that four gunmen disembarked from a uniquely marked Renault sedan and started firing. Was there a driver? Or did the attackers leave the vehicle unattended during their murderous rampage?

    How many shooters were there? I’ve heard at least six — the four who escaped in the Renault sedan and two who were shot and killed by Russian security personnel. But I also saw the interview with one of the Russian patrons who was waiting for the concert to start. He claims he disarmed one of the terrorists and delivered a knock out blow. So, if my math is correct, that is at least 7 shooters. Where did the other three come from? Was there a separate vehicle?

    Then we have the insane performance at Monday’s State Department press conference by flack Matthew Miller. I repeat the question I raised in a previous article — What did the U.S. Government know and when did it know it? Miller’s “confidence” about who was not responsible is total bullshit. In my 35 years holding clearances and dealing directly with the aftermath of terrorist events I cannot recall a single time that we had advance information about an attack that enabled us to pronounce within minutes of the attack who DID NOT set off the bomb, hijack the plane or shoot up the dance club. Yet Miller, who is a calloused liar, insists Ukraine is innocent and relies on tautology to make his case.

    Miller also insists that the United States “warned” Russia. Yet the evidence suggests otherwise. Russia’s Ambassador to the United States, who is about three miles from Main State, was not briefed on the threat by Secretary Blinken on any of his lackeys. Nor did US Embassy Moscow seek a meeting with Foreign Minister Lavrov or the head of the SVR to brief them on the “intel” the U.S. claimed to possess. If you have knowledge of an impending terrorist attack and fail to inform the nation that faces the threat, it naturally raises the suspicion that you are involved or tainted in some way.

    There was “breaking news” as the Judge and I began our Monday morning chat — the UN Security Council approved a resolution calling for an immediate cease fire in Gaza, with the U.S. abstaining. This is a welcome gesture but it is not likely to compel Israel to end its attacks on Palestinian.

    Why did the Biden Administration agree to let the resolution go forward? I believe it is nothing more than political theater. The Biden administration is trying to Boul the voters who are Muslim, American or Arab American in key state, such as Michigan. But this is no way obligates the United States to suspend sending military assistance to Israel. Furthermore, I believe the Biden administration coordinated this action with Israel. They are using this pretend US opposition as a way to placate American voters who oppose Biden’s staunch pro-Israel policy. While Bibi Netanyahu ordered two of his government officials to stay at home and not visit Washington, he also did not order Defense Minister Gallant to return to Israel immediately. Nope. The Gallant stayed on to have consultations with the US department of defense and the Biden administration. In other words business as usual.

    I think the Biden team is calculating that liberal Jewish Democrat voters are not going to abandon him, and that this “new position” will suffice to persuade Arab American and Muslim American voters that Biden is their friend after all. It is a cynical and disgusting policy, but that is Washington.
